raptor3x Senior Member More info Post edited over 8 years ago by raptor3x. | That shot was a backhand loop from a European professional player so in truth, it's very doubtful that the logo would sharp at 1/1000th of a second as the ball will be spinning at ~6000RPM. But even if it wasn't sharp, you'd expect the ball to rotate something like 30 degrees during the exposure, you would still be able to see where the logo was if it was on the correct side.
